Summary

In a company's data infrastructure, integrating disparate data sources into a central repository like Databricks is common, but moving this data to operational tools such as Salesforce can be challenging due to the lack of native sync integration. The blog details four methods for syncing data from Databricks to Salesforce, emphasizing the benefits of such integration for various teams like sales and marketing, who can leverage rich first-party data for enhanced performance. Exporting data involves using Databricks Notebooks, CLI, JSpark, or a more streamlined approach through reverse ETL using tools like Fivetran Activations, which bypasses manual CSV exports and allows seamless data synchronization from Databricks to multiple applications. The reverse ETL method offers a more efficient alternative by enabling scheduled syncs, ensuring Salesforce always has the most current data, supported by comprehensive documentation and customer support. Readers are encouraged to select the method that best suits their expertise and organizational needs.
